UEFA actually doing something good........
The amount clubs can charge for away tickets in Europe's three men's club competitions will be reduced this season, Uefa has announced.
Champions League games will be capped at 60 euros (£50.55), with 40 euros (£33.70) the maximum for the Europa League and just 20 euros (£16.85) for the Conference League.
Next season the Champions League figure will drop to 50 euros (£42.12) with 35 euros (£29.48) for the Europa League.
These caps only apply to visiting fans, not home supporters.

UEFA originally wanted the group stage to be 10 games each rather than 8.jacob_CAFC said:
I think they are doing it in alternating weeks nowForeverAddickted said:Wait there are Champions League games on a Thursday now?
When are Europa and Conference League games, are they not creating a clash and harming their own "minor" competitions?
They accounted for that in the scheduling originally but now have more weeks than they need. So instead they’re doing a couple of weeks where it’s only Champions League, Europa League or Conference League to say they are “showcasing” the smaller competitions.
Most weeks I am guessing they squeeze the Champions League back to Tue/Wed as per previous seasons.2 -
